At a glance

Andronis honors Santorini's ancient cave-dwelling tradition with whitewashed volumes carved into the caldera cliffs.

Best for: Architecture enthusiasts seeking authentic Cycladic vernacular

Highlights:

  • Carved into volcanic caldera cliffs following centuries-old skaftia cave-dwelling tradition
  • Interiors feature barrel-vaulted ceilings and polished volcanic-grey concrete floors
  • West-facing pool terraces overlook Thirassia and Palea Kameni islets at sunset

PB hotel design editorial

Carved directly into the volcanic caldera cliffs of Oia, where the island's northwestern tip drops dramatically toward the submerged crater below, the buildings that house Andronis Boutique Hotel follow the logic of the hillside rather than imposing upon it. The cascade of whitewashed cubic volumes, connected by exterior staircases and terraced at different elevations, continues a vernacular tradition of cave dwelling — skaftia — that predates tourism on Santorini by centuries. What distinguishes Andronis from its neighbors is the precision with which that tradition has been honored: rounded arches cut through thick pumice walls, barrel-vaulted ceilings shelter sleeping alcoves set into the rock, and polished concrete floors in volcanic grey run continuously from wall to wall, referencing the island's igneous geology without resorting to imitation. The interiors balance the weightiness of the cave volumes against a deliberate lightness of furnishing — beds on sculpted concrete platforms, Bertoia wire chairs in powder-coat white, walls left entirely unadorned so that the architecture speaks for itself. Rust-red shade sails punctuate the exterior terraces, a warm counterpoint to all that white render. The pool terraces, oriented due west across the caldera toward Thirassia and the volcanic islets of Palea Kameni, become the hotel's true social rooms after sundown, when candlelit tables are arranged poolside and the Aegean drops from deep cobalt to black beneath a horizon still holding the last traces of color.
